Young Fruit Tree care.

Hi,

I have a peach tree, nectarine tree, and white peach tree all planted last summer (June 2019). They have new growth by all the branches are small and they are beginning to flower. Should I pinch the buds off? And when and how should I be pruning these trees? I live in Prairie Grove, Arkansas. We are in growing zone 7b. I also have blueberry bushes I planted in June of 2019 and they have many buds that are beginning to set fruit but they don’t have too many stems and aren’t very full of foliage, should I pinch the fruit off to help them grow stronger this year? I planted them as young plants, probably a year old at the time of transplant. Attached please find photos of the blueberry bush, white peach, dwarf peach, and nectarine trees in that order. Finally, I planted (in June of 2018) several blackberry bushes. Should I be pinching the flowers/buds off those or pruning them at all? Same question for the blueberry bushes.
